Salmon Cakes with Creamy Garlic Sauce

Indulge in the deliciousness of homemade Salmon Cakes with Creamy Garlic Sauce. These crispy, golden-brown patties are bursting with flavor, combining fresh salmon and zesty garlic in a creamy dip that elevates every bite. Perfect for weeknight dinners or elegant gatherings, this dish is easy to prepare and sure to impress.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 lb fresh salmon fillets
  • 1 cup plain or panko breadcrumbs
  • 1/4 cup green onions, chopped
  • 2 large eggs, beaten
  • 2 tbsp lemon juice
  • Salt and pepper, to taste
  • 1/2 cup full-fat sour cream
  • 2 garlic cloves, minced
  • 2 tbsp fresh dill, chopped

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C). Cook salmon fillets in a skillet over medium heat for 5-7 minutes on each side until fully cooked. Let cool and flake into small pieces.
  2. In a large bowl, mix flaked salmon, breadcrumbs, green onions, beaten eggs, lemon juice, salt, and pepper until well combined.
  3. Form the mixture into compact patties, about 2 inches wide. Place them on a parchment-lined baking sheet.
  4. Bake for 20-25 minutes or until golden brown, flipping halfway through.
  5. While baking, combine sour cream, minced garlic, and dill in a small bowl. Adjust seasoning to taste.
  6. Serve warm with creamy garlic sauce.
